Automatic bleed nipples17 Jul 2007 22:27 GMT3
I recently salvaged a bleed nipple from a spare back axle and found it
was automatic: the cone is spring loaded, so when the nipple is undone
it acts as a one-way valve. When the nipple is done up it clamps the
cone shut as usual.
